Record

[6 Sep. 1318:]
[Repetition of order to distrain William and Agnes at the Green in land formerly held by William Springold and Robhood.][1]

IRHB comments

Does this refer to William Robhood? The Robhoods of Walsham le Willows (Suffolk) occur frequently in the manor court rolls throughout the period covered (1316-99). For full discussion, genealogy and listings of records, see Robhoods of Walsham le Willows (record texts).
